Turn 6


With the Minotaur well and truly dead, the adventurers rushed in to take their share of the spoils, then they returned victorious back through the portal. Johnny made sure to bring back the dead body of Sally, so that her family could pay their respects. The adventurers who didn't dare to fight stood in shock as the bloody victors emerged. The same guy who introduced everybody at the beginning came back through the portal along with a cleric, a shopkeep, and a decorated soldier.

"Ahh, congratulations. I just received word from our client that the Minotaur is dead. You guys left quire a mess at the mining site, but luckily for us, our client is in charge of cleaning up the messes. Wow... There are a lot more of you than I expected." He glanced at Johnny carrying dead Sally. "Only one death... unfortunate. But no matter, I suppose that we will simply need to extend the orientation, and pick a slightly more powerful monster to test your mettle. For the time being, our cleric here will heal you of any injuries, you can buy random trinkets from our shopkeeper here, and our Sargent here will teach any of you he deems worthy some more advanced techniques, because i'll be honest, you all looked like shit out there."

Abdul came to the cleric to heal his bruises and fractured ribs from when the boulder fragments struck him. The cleric said "Ahh, broken bones. This will hurt." A green orb appeared on his staff, then Abdul started writhing in pain for a few seconds, but once the cleric was finished, Abdul stood up and said, "A miracle, the end has been averted! You must teach me how it works." The cleric laughed, then said, "magic healing doesn't work like the scrolls say it does. We simply rapidly accelerate the space-time continuum right in the injured areas, meaning a month-long healing process becomes only a few seconds! However, this process has been shown to cause premature aging of the injured areas for some reason..." "Fascinating," Abdul exclaimed, before walking off to the sargent.

Werther came out of the portal last, and the cleric was frightened, "Oh my gosh! You poor thing, how are you still alive!?" Now that the battle was over, Werther was beginning to feel the pain in his face again. The right side of his face was well and truly numb, as it was mauled beyond recognition, but his left side was smarting from the six long scratches. The cleric immediately got to work, and new folds of dark, scarred skin stretched over the injuries. The process was painless, but Werther looked badass once it was done. His left face was slightly indented, and his cheek was missing, exposing his fearsome teeth from the side. Dark skin covered the rest of it. His right face had two sets of 3 parallel scars running at slightly different angles, intersecting each other as they ran from his neck to his nose. "All done. I'm sorry I couldn't do more." The cleric said. Werther also wandered to the shopkeep and sargent.

The other's also took trips to the sargent and the shopkeeper to trade in their trophies for better equipment and skills. Jhoferi looked disappointed about something, but suddenly happy when he saw what the shop offered. Burklaif was also particularly excited for the items i stock. They all lined up, carrying valuable trophies of War. Werther had in his mouth the skull of the Minotaur, Saraket had skinned the beast and carried the fur over his shoulder. Johnny had one of the horns, and Abdul had the other (Abdul's horn had Werther's bite marks in it, so it wasn't as valuable) Burklaif had ripped the femur out of the Minotaur's leg, and carried it in his mouth, chewing on it. And Jhoferi carried several teeth. The shopkeeper looked most impatient for this round of trading.

EDIT: Umm, hey, I just noticed a problem with this:
I want this game to emphasise lots of people working together rather than a couple of powerful people.
XP and loot are based on how much damage you do.
As you level up, you can deal - and take - more damage. This is also the case for getting more loot.
Either enemies will become more powerful, or remain at one power level (probably get more powerful).
This will mean that people with more experience will be able to get even more experience, while new people are more likely to die before they can really get experience, or at the very least will get a far smaller share of the loot and experience.
As time goes on, powerful people will rise to the top, and the newer/weaker people will get left behind.
You see the problem?

That is why I made leveling up not increase damage anymore, (a few turns ago. I mentioned it in the ooc section.) While leveling Indie's make you tanker, your damage output will more or less stay the same. Damage stays about the sane each level, but the exp requirement goes up by a lot. This means that the health discrepancy won't be as big as you think, and higher level people won't have access to free full heals as easily as lower level people.

As for the monsters, I think the damage was quite alright. I just need to make them have more health, or give them more options so they aren't a pushover as soon as you kill one leg. Next monster will keep that in mind.
